      Age Regulations of West Virginia

      Bartenders can start serving alcoholic beverages at the age of 16 under the supervision of someone 21 or older, and those who are 18 or older can serve without the need for supervision.

      Bartending Laws and Regulations in West Virginia

      In West Virginia, the West Virginia Alcohol Beverage Control Administration (ABCA) oversees the regulation of alcohol sales and service, including bartending laws. The hours during which alcohol can be sold and served may vary, and establishments must comply with specific regulations regarding opening and closing times; violating these laws can result in penalties, fines, or even the suspension of a business's alcohol license.
